3 min Analytics

Snowflake automatiseert met Adaptive Compute resourcebeheer

Snowflake automatiseert met Adaptive Compute resourcebeheer

Snowflake heeft een nieuwe compute service aangekondigd voor het automatisch beheren van infrastructuur. Adaptive Compute selecteert automatisch de juiste cluster grootte en het aantal clusters voor specifieke taken. Ook de auto-suspend en resume-duur wordt automatisch bepaald op basis van de workload.

“Gebruikers hoeven niet langer na te denken over de warehouse grootte, concurrency instellingen, multi-cluster warehouse settings of auto-suspend/resume semantics”, aldus Snowflake bij de aankondiging tijdens de jaarlijkse Snowflake Summit. Adaptive Compute gebruikt intelligente technologie om queries naar de juiste clusters te brengen. Gebruikers hoeven daarvoor geen actie te ondernemen.

Snowflake zal de warehouses ondersteunen die met de Adaptive Compute-dienst gemaakt zijn. Deze noemt het bedrijf ook wel Adaptive Warehouses. Alle Adaptive Warehouses binnen een account maken gebruik van een gedeelde resource pool. Dit moet de efficiëntie maximaliseren door optimaal gebruik te maken van beschikbare computing power. Gebruikers behouden wel hun vertrouwde billing model en granulaire informatie via ACCOUNT_USAGE views.

Migratie zonder downtime

Het overstappen van een standaard virtual warehouse naar een Adaptive Warehouse gebeurt via een simpel alter-commando. Snowflake benadrukt dat dit proces geen downtime vereist. Klanten kunnen hun productie workloads in batches converteren, terwijl bestaande warehouse-namen, policies en permissions behouden blijven. Hieronder een afbeelding van hoe het creëren van een standaard warehouse verschilt van Adaptive Warehouses.

Snowflake automatiseert met Adaptive Compute resourcebeheer

De aanpak komt tegemoet aan een veelgehoorde klacht die Snowflake signaleerde bij gebruikers. Warehouse-namen zijn vaak hardcoded in pipelines en scripts, waardoor consolidatie van workloads traditiegetrouw een tijdrovend en disruptief proces kan zijn. Met de nieuwe service kunnen organisaties hun infrastructuur optimaliseren zonder operationele verstoring.

Betere prijs-prestatie verhouding

Adaptive Compute maakt gebruik van de nieuwste hardware en performance enhancements die Snowflake beschikbaar heeft. De service is ontworpen om automatisch prestaties te verbeteren door regelmatige verfijningen van de core engine.

De geoptimaliseerde resource sharing zorgt ervoor dat queries kunnen profiteren van een gedeelde pool van clusters binnen het account. Dit moet de efficiëntie verhogen en kosten reduceren voor organisaties die meerdere workloads draaien.

Adaptive Compute bevindt zich momenteel in private preview. Snowflake heeft nog geen definitieve releasedatum bekendgemaakt voor algemene beschikbaarheid. De service moet onderdeel worden van het bredere aanbod om organisaties te helpen meer waarde uit hun data te halen zonder de complexiteit van infrastructuurbeheer.

Standard Warehouse Generation 2 brengt significante prestatieverbetering

Naast Adaptive Compute kan het Snowflake-platform nog op andere nieuwe features rekenen. De cloud data-provider heeft naast automation namelijk ook ingezet op prestatie-optimalisaties. Met Standard Warehouse Generation 2 (Gen2) belooft Snowflake aanzienlijk snellere query-uitvoering. Deze verbeterde versie bevat geüpdatete hardware en aanvullende performance enhancements. Snowflake stelt dat klanten over de afgelopen twaalf maanden 2,1x snellere prestaties hebben ervaren voor core analytics workloads.

Tip: Snowflake Openflow haalt data uit ieder bedrijfssysteem